Mixed results for the Eagles

Sunshine Eagles were left to rue missed chances in Baseball Victoria Summer League men’s division 1.

Facing top side Geelong Baycats, the Eagles lost 5-2.

The Eagles led for most of the game and had their opportunities to take the points.

The Eagles enter the break sitting third with a 4-2 record.

The two sides will also face each other in the first match back after the break on January 22.

The Eagles women’s team continued their strong form in the division 3 west competition.

Also facing the Baycats, the Eagles won 14-7.

The Eagles are undefeated heading into the Christmas break.

The Eagles will have an extra week break, with a bye the first round back.
